lapply(yourList, function(x1,x2,x3){x1*x2*x3}, x2=12, x3=34) ?lapply lapply(X, FUN, ...)
sapply(X, FUN, ..., simplify = TRUE, USE.NAMES = TRUE) replicate(n, expr, simplify = TRUE) Arguments X a vector (atomic or list) or an expressions vector. Other objects (including classed objects) will be coerced by as.list. FUN the function to be applied to each element of X: see ‘Details’. In the case of functions like +, %*%, etc., the function name must be backquoted or quoted. ... optional arguments to FUN. Noitce the '...' which are the "optional arguments to FUN".
